Language Comparison: Afar vs Tetum
Explore the linguistic characteristics and features of both languages
Aspect
Afar
Tetum
Family
Afro-Asiatic
Austronesian, Malayo-Polynesian
Speakers
Approximately 2.7 million
Around 800,000 speakers (including second-language speakers)
Features
Spoken by the Afar people in the Horn of Africa, notable for its Cushitic roots
An Austronesian language with significant Portuguese influence, serving as one of the two official languages of Timor-Leste; simple grammar and shared vocabulary with Indonesian/Malay
Countries
Ethiopia, Eritrea, Djibouti
Timor-Leste and Indonesia.
Writing System
Latin script, previously used Arabic script
Latin script
Tonal
No
No
Grammatical Cases
No, but has extensive use of suffixes to indicate case functions
No, relies on word order and prepositions
Derived From
Part of the Cushitic branch of the Afro-Asiatic language family
Proto-Austronesian, with heavy Portuguese lexical influence
Loanwords
From Arabic, Italian, and other local languages
From Portuguese, Malay/Indonesian, and Arabic
Dialects
There are variations but not distinctly categorized into widely recognized dialects
Includes Tetun Dili (urban variety with heavy Portuguese influence) and Tetun Terik (more traditional and rural variety)
